New York: Harry N. Abrams, Inc., Publisher, 2004. Book. Near Fine. Hardcover. Signed by Author(s). First Edition. 4to - over 9¾ - 12" tall. Large format hardcover, case-bound in printed pictorial paper covered boards, in publisher's non price-clipped dust-jacket. 208 pages. Bibliographic References and Index. Profusely illustrated with 196 photographs and paintings, 84 of which are in color. First edition, first printing with full number line. Signed and dated by author on half-title page. No previous ownership marks. Very mild spine cant from shelving. A clean, fresh, unmarked and near like new copy. Near fine in a fine dust-jacket.
